Easy Copycat KFC Chicken Breast Recipe

Making KFC chicken breast at home helps you control ingredients, reduce cost, and adjust flavor. You get a crispy outside and juicy inside without relying on fast food.

KFC Chicken breast copycat recipe

Ingredients You Need

Use fresh ingredients for the best results.

Main Ingredients

  • 1 whole chicken (cut into 8 pieces or use chicken breasts)
  • 1 cup buttermilk
  • 1 egg (beaten)
  • Oil for frying (canola or peanut)

Coating Mix (11 Herbs & Spices)

Ingredient

Amount

All-purpose flour

2 cups

Salt

2 tsp

Dried thyme

1½ tsp

Dried basil

1½ tsp

Dried oregano

1 tsp

Celery salt

1 tbsp

Black pepper

1 tbsp

Yellow mustard powder

1 tbsp

Paprika

¼ cup

Garlic salt

2 tbsp

Ground ginger

1 tbsp

White pepper

3 tbsp

Optional:

  • MSG (for authentic flavor boost)

Step-by-Step Instructions

Follow these steps carefully to get perfect KFC chicken breast texture.

Step 1: Marinate the Chicken

  • Mix buttermilk and egg in a bowl
  • Add chicken pieces
  • Marinate for 30 minutes (or overnight for better flavor)

Step 2: Prepare the Coating

  • Mix flour with all herbs and spices
  • Keep the mixture dry and well combined

Step 3: Heat the Oil

  • Heat oil to 350°F (175°C)
  • Use a thermometer for accuracy

Step 4: Coat the Chicken

  • Remove chicken from marinade
  • Press into flour mixture once
  • Shake off excess coating

Step 5: Fry the Chicken

  • Place chicken carefully in hot oil
  • Fry for about 10–12 minutes
  • Turn halfway for even cooking
  • Don’t fry in bunch but one by one

Step 6: Finish in Oven

  • Preheat oven to 175°F (80°C)
  • Place fried chicken on a wire rack
  • Keep warm for 15–20 minutes

Step 7: Add Final Flavor

  • Lightly sprinkle MSG (optional)
  • Serve hot for best taste

Key Cooking Tips for Best Results

These tips improve your KFC chicken breast outcome:

  • Do not overcrowd the fryer
  • Always maintain oil temperature at 350°F
  • Use a wire rack to keep chicken crispy
  • Avoid double coating for better texture

FAQs

How many calories are in a KFC Original Recipe chicken breast?

A KFC Original Recipe chicken breast has about 390 calories per serving. This can vary slightly by location and preparation.

What is the difference between Original Recipe and Extra Crispy chicken breasts?

Extra Crispy chicken breasts have more calories and fat. They contain around 530 calories and 35g fat, while Original Recipe has about 390 calories and 21g fat.

Are KFC chicken breasts gluten-free?

No. KFC chicken breasts are not gluten-free because the breading contains wheat.

What allergens are found in KFC chicken?

KFC chicken may contain egg, milk, soy, and wheat. There is also a risk of cross-contact during preparation.
